We address the problem of interpreting visual surveil-lancedata by learning appropriate spatio-temporal sub-spacesof active image regions caused by scene activities.We focus on identifying regions of sustained change forrecognising key stages of a visual behaviour. Our behaviourrepresentation is based on the asynchrony or delay patternsof occurrence among local events which need notbe spatially connected. We use an automatic NormalisedCut structure discovery algorithm with a hybrid similaritycriteria for simultaneously identifying relevant spatio-temporalsubspaces and clustering similar behaviour pat-ternsin those subspaces. We compare the automaticallydiscovered classes with conceptual classes of behaviours ina semi-constrained "Shopping" scenario.
